Triple Chocolate you ask?? Lemme explain.

Triple chocolate chip cookies on white parchment paper

Chocolate number one: cocoa powder for an all around, complete, deep chocolate flavor.

Triple chocolate chip cookies on white parchment paper

Chocolate number two: semisweet chocolate chips. These are triple chocolate chip cookies after all

Triple chocolate chip cookies on white parchment paper

Chocolate number three: dark chocolate chunks. BIG chunks, as in chop up a 60% cacao baking bar and fold it into the batter.

Triple Chocolate Chip Cookies


  • Author: Aberdeen
  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 12-16 Cookies

Description

The best ever soft, chewy, decadent cookies bursting with three different types of chocolate!


Ingredients

  • ½ cup + 2 tablespoons cocoa powder
  • 1 cup fl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• ¼ teaspoon sea salt
  • 2 teaspoons corn starch
  • ½ cup + 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, room temperature
  • ¾ cup brown sugar
  • ¼ cup white sugar
  • 1 egg, room temperature
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• ½ cup semi-sweet chocolate morsels
  • ½ cup dark chocolate chunks (I used a 60% cacao Ghiradelli baking bar and diced it up!)
  • Sea salt flakes to garnish


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350˚F. Prepare a baking sheet with a silpat or parchment paper
  2. In a medium bowl, mix together cocoa powder, flour, baking soda, sea salt, and corn starch until completely combined.
  3. In a large bowl, cream together butter and sugars. Whisk in the egg and vanilla extract until thoroughly mixed.
  4. Stir the flour mixture into the sugar mixture until thoroughly combined.
  5. Gently fold in chocolate chips and chocolate chunks.
  6. Cover in saran wrap and chill dough for 20 minutes.
  7. After chilling, scoop and balls of dough, about 2 tablespoons each, onto the prepared baking sheet.
  8. Bake 8-10 minutes, being careful not to overcook! Remove from the oven when they look almost but not quite done. They will still be quite soft in the center.
  9. Sprinkle with sea salt flakes as desired and let cool on the baking sheet for 5 more minutes. Remove to a wire rack to cool completely.
  • Prep Time: 30 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
